- Volume controls with slider for the WIN!!! GG on that in the opening menu! Thank you! The opening pop up narration box to introduce the player to the mechanics of the game and the lore is a huge win. Helps to hook the player into the world and game. It was difficult to understand how to progress the narration. I didn't know when to click the stick to progress things vs when to hit space bar to progress the narration. Would help if that were more clear, or just consistent. Like, player reads the dialogue box, hits space to make it go away and then do what is being explained. I also had trouble seeing where the character, the stick, was. Lol. It blended in and I clicked around a bit trying to find it at first. Perhaps highlighting it with a white or yellow border would help in that first introduction level. The sound effects were all very good. I liked the old school feel of them and they helped make the hitting of the stick feel impactful. One thing I'd advise is making the audible countdown start at 10. It was a bit loud and felt a bit too long. The music is really good. It feels hype in a fun way and it matches the game's vibe really well. I love the shop. Very well designed. Clear and easy to see what things are when you hover over. It was easy to see how much I had to spend and how much each item cost. Really good job on this! The world was very well designed and laid out. Each level felt new and different even though items were repeated in them. The theme interpretation of your character being a stick and it being used like a destructive pinball was wild and just plain fun. I could see you adding different color schemes for different levels with different music changes as well. You did a good job with your game design document. This game was well put together and was quite fun! I hope you are proud of what you achieved and I hope you continue to work on the game. Thank you for your submission. GG!

Summarise your game!
You are Stickolas, a stick that a wizard is sending into people's homes to break their stuff and steal their munny. Fling yourself around and bounce off walls to destroy items and get munny. Spend that munny with the wizard to upgrade your destructive power. How will it all end. Jail? Freedom? Love!?!?
Please explain how your game fits the theme:
You play as an animated stick being used by a dubious wizard as a weapon of grand larceny
